Abstract
1,058,360. Pistons. SOC. D'EXPLOITATION DES MATERIELS HISPANO-SUIZA. Dec. 23, 1965 [Dec. 29, 1964], No. 54600/65. Heading F2T. A piston for an I.C. engine comprises a central body 4 which co-operates with a sliding cap 9 to define an oil chamber 12, the inlet and outlet orifices 22, 24 of which are closed by co-operating parts of the body and cap when the cap is moved towards the body under a given pressure in the cylinder. Oil is supplied to the chamber 12 through the connecting rod 7, gudgeon pin 8 and passages 41 to interconnecting grooves 23 and radial slots 22, the outlet from the chamber being through clearance space 24 and ducts 24a in a limiting stop 16. The orifices are closed when concentric bearing surfaces 18, 20 and 19, 21 come into contact. In another embodiment, Figs. 3 and 4 (not shown), the inlet orifice is closed when a groove 27 in the cap no longer registers with inlet slots 26 and the outlet orifice is closed when a shoulder 28 on the cap engages within the clearance space 24. The body 4 may be made of a light alloy, preferably one containing silicon, and the cap made of chromium steel.
